Origin & History
Fiddlehead ferns, specifically the young, coiled fronds of the ostrich fern (*Matteuccia struthiopteris*), are a seasonal delicacy. They are commonly found in temperate regions across North America, Europe, and Asia. Valued for their unique flavor and dense nutritional profile, fiddleheads are a cherished ingredient in functional nutrition.
Historical & Cultural Context
Fiddlehead ferns have been consumed for centuries by indigenous peoples and rural communities across Native American, Japanese, and Scandinavian cultures. Traditionally harvested in spring, these greens were valued for their nutritional benefits and unique flavor, symbolizing renewal and health. Today, they remain a celebrated seasonal superfood in culinary traditions worldwide.

How It Works
The primary mechanism involves potent antioxidant activity attributed to phenolic compounds (e.g., chlorogenic acid, caffeic acid), flavonoids (e.g., rutin, quercetin, kaempferol), and carotenoids (e.g., lutein, zeaxanthin). These bioactives scavenge free radicals, reduce oxidative stress, and modulate inflammatory pathways. Additionally, high dietary fiber content directly supports digestive regularity and gut health.
Clinical Summary
Research on fiddlehead ferns primarily focuses on identifying and quantifying their bioactive compounds, such as phenolics (up to 51.6 mg gallic acid equiv. g⁻¹ DW) and flavonoids (up to 178,778 mg/100g in *P. aquilinum*), through *in vitro* and *ex vivo* studies. While these analyses indicate strong antioxidant and nutritional potential, robust human clinical trials are currently lacking to establish specific health outcomes or therapeutic dosages. Most current evidence is derived from compositional analysis rather than controlled clinical interventions on humans.

Preparation & Dosage
- Must be cooked thoroughly (boiled or steamed for 10-15 minutes) to neutralize naturally occurring toxins; never consume raw. - Commonly prepared by sautéing with olive oil, garlic, or lemon, or added to soups, stir-fries, and pasta dishes. - A typical serving size is 1 cup (approximately 100 grams) of cooked fiddlehead ferns.

Safety & Interactions
Fiddlehead ferns must be properly and thoroughly cooked before consumption to neutralize potential toxins, such as ptaquiloside found in species like *Pteridium aquilinum* (Bracken Fern), which is associated with carcinogenicity. Raw fiddleheads can cause gastrointestinal upset and foodborne illness. While cardiac glycosides (e.g., digoxin 45.9%, ouabain 16%) have been identified, their bioavailability and clinical relevance from typical dietary intake are not well-established, though caution is advised. Pregnant individuals should ensure proper cooking and moderate consumption.
